The grey market premium (GMP) is a key indicator of investor sentiment for an upcoming Initial Public Offering (IPO). It represents the price investors are willing to pay for the shares in the unofficial market before the listing. A positive GMP suggests high demand, while a negative or low figure often points to bearish expectations.
Currently, the GMP for the NSE IPO is around ₹207. This figure is derived from market trends over the last 10 sessions, which have seen the premium fluctuate between a low of ₹192 and a high of ₹310. The current level indicates a cautious outlook, as the premium is below its recent peak but still positive.
For investors, this data offers a preview of how the stock might perform on its listing day. A GMP of ₹207 implies the listing price could be higher than the issue price, but the volatility seen in the grey market suggests that the final price will depend on market conditions on the listing date.
